Title:
|
Tauberian Theory for Multivariate Regularly Varying Distributions with Application to Preferential Attachment Networks

Abstract:
|
Abel-Tauberian theorems relate power law behavior of distributions and their transforms. We formulate and prove a multivariate version for non-standard regularly varying measures on the positive p-dimensional quadrant and then apply it to prove that the joint distribution of in- and out-degree in a directed edge preferential attachment model has jointly regularly varying tails. (Joint with G. Samorodnitsky)
